(please explain how you got your answer, thank you)
Your last doctor’s visit cost $105. Health insurance through your employer paid $84, and you paid the remaining $21. What percentage of the cost did you pay?
A) 20%
B) 21%
C) 25%
D) 80%
E) 84%

A, 20%, because 21 divided by 105 times 100 is 20%.
